Why is mental health so important? And what steps can you take to improve it
Mental health refers to the state of your mind and emotional well-being. It can affect how you feel, think and act, how you relate to others, how you sleep, eat, work learn, play, or just enjoy your life.
Mental health is an important topic for everyone. However, when we speak of mental health we often refer to it as depression. Depression is a serious illness that strikes millions of Americans each and every year.
A medical doctor must treat depression, which is known as clinical depression. There are many kinds of depression.
According to the National Institute of Mental Health, depression is "a common mood disorder that causes depression most of the time, a loss of interest in nearly all activities, feelings of guilt, low self-worth, disturbed sleep, appetite, poor concentration, thoughts of suicide or death."
Different people may experience depression in different ways. Others may feel helpless, sad, hopeless and unmotivated. Others may feel empty and unmotivated. Other people may feel nothing.
Depression is treatable. You can get help for depression by taking medications, exercising, changing your diet, or making lifestyle changes. Depression can lead to problems at home, school and work if it is not treated.
Depression is more common in women than it is in men, but both men and women are affected. Depression is the leading cause worldwide of disability among men and woman aged 15 to 44.
